Indifference Curve
A graph representing combinations of goods among which a consumer is indifferent, reflecting preferences.
Combinations
In mathematics and statistics, combinations refer to the selection of items from a group, where the order of selection does not matter.
Total Utility
The overall satisfaction or pleasure a person derives from consuming a certain quantity of goods or services.
Marginal Utilities
The increased enjoyment or benefit obtained by a user from the consumption of one more unit of a good or service.
